IMU-856 is an orally available, systemically acting small molecule modulator that targets Sirtuin 6 (SIRT6), a protein serving as a transcriptional regulator of intestinal barrier function and regeneration of bowel epithelium. Its mechanism aims to restore the gut wall and barrier function, offering a novel approach for gastrointestinal diseases such as celiac disease, inflammatory bowel disease, Graft-versus-Host Disease, and other disorders associated with impaired intestinal barrier function. Unlike immunosuppressive therapies, IMU-856 does not suppress immune cells in preclinical studies and may maintain immune surveillance during therapy. In clinical trials for celiac disease, it demonstrated improvements in histology (gut architecture), symptoms, biomarkers, nutrient absorption (e.g., vitamin B12 uptake), and was well tolerated without dose-limiting toxicities or significant adverse events. Additionally, post hoc analyses showed a dose-dependent increase in endogenous glucagon-like peptide-1 (GLP-1) levels and reduced body weight gain/food consumption in preclinical models—suggesting potential utility for weight management[1][2][3][8].
